Before you dive into the application process, take time to read and understand the loan's terms and conditions. This includes the interest rates, repayment schedules, and any fees or penalties that could be involved. Familiarising yourself with these aspects helps prevent any unpleasant surprises in the future and empowers you to make an informed decision.
Verify that the lender is credible and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) in the UK. You can achieve this by checking their registration number or searching for the lender on the FCA's official website. A credible lender will not hesitate to display this information on their platform. Avoid lenders that promise guarantees or unusually low interest rates, as these can be red flags for scams.
When applying for a loan online, you will be asked to provide sensitive information such as your National Insurance number, bank details, and income information. Ensure that the website is secure by checking for 'https://' at the beginning of the URL and a padlock icon in the address bar. Never disclose your details through unsecured connections or non-trusted platforms, as they can be phishing attempts.
Protect your accounts with strong, unique passwords and change them regularly. Enabling two-factor authentication (2FA) provides an additional layer of security, requiring a second piece of information (like a code sent to your phone) when logging in. This significantly reduces the chances of unauthorised access.
Keeping your computer, antivirus software, and browser up to date is vital for online safety. Security vulnerabilities in outdated software can be exploited by cybercriminals to access your sensitive information. Regular updates ensure that your system has the latest security features and patches.
Be cautious of unsolicited loan offers received via email, text, or social media. Scammers often use these channels to lure unsuspecting victims with 'too-good-to-be-true' loan offers. If you receive an offer that you did not request, it's best to ignore or delete it without clicking on any links or providing any information.
